Output ffb18e264287f12b9e2431069ddfdfd9c96822b6587dd6568a55f680f429587c:10

value
15424550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d545f142f5f82b935f41a8c57c40127d76c1414 OP_EQUAL
address
3ACVqcSB4WBdxgEW6Qu63Bm67ib7JdjMaH
transaction
ffb18e264287f12b9e2431069ddfdfd9c96822b6587dd6568a55f680f429587c
confirmations
301253
spent
true